I bought an 8 lb jug of IMR 4895, it was cheap and available. Hodgdon's site show's a max charge of 45.4 grains, with a 168 BTHP. I loaded 15 rounds at 44.8, we'll see what they do at 100 yards. I plan on stepping it down .5 grains at a time, until I find a charge that shoot's a good, tight group. Maybe I'll get real lucky and 44.8 will be "in the zone".:D I'm an experienced handloader, I'm comfortable approaching the max charge. I'm not interested in starting at the minimum load, because with the 20" barrel on my Remmy 700 SPS, I'd be getting 2400 fps, lol. I'm guessing the most accurate load will be with 43+ grains. One way or another, I'll find a good load with this powder.:)
 
I fired 15 rounds loaded at 44.8 grains today, three (5) shot groups, they were 1.1", 1", and .90" at 100 yards. The last group had (4) rounds in one hole!:D I think this is a good load, I hesitate to mess with it. I might go ahead and try 44.5 grains, if the groups open up any, I'll know that 44.8 is where its at.:)
